Identifying Transformations
Which could a dilation result in? Select all that apply.
a figure getting smaller
a figure moving to the left
a figure flipping upside down
a figure getting larger
a figure turning about a point

All Answers 1

Answered by GPT-5 mini AI
Select:
- a figure getting smaller
- a figure getting larger

Reason: a dilation scales all distances from a center (making the figure larger or smaller). It does not rotate (turn about a point) or reflect (flip upside down). While points can shift location relative to axes depending on the center, a pure translation ("moving to the left") is not what a dilation does.
